The North America Transportation team for Devices and Services plays a critical role in delivering the Pixel portfolio (Pixel Phone, Pixel Buds, Pixel Watch) to customers. This team willl manage the flow of goods from factories to regional Google Distribution Centers, and then to various channels: retailers (B2B), Googlers (B2G), Google stores, and final consumers (B2C). This team also facilitates reverse logistics for repairs and warehouse replenishment. Collaborating with premium freight forwarders and domestic carriers, it ensures on-time delivery and provide exceptional customer service to internal and external stakeholders through timely communication and issue resolution.

As the Transportation Manager for the North America Pixel Portfolio, you will lead the transportation strategy and execution, you will be responsible for scaling the Google Store transportation multi-channel capabilities, securing timely deliveries for Googlers in the B2G Network and non-commercial launch units, optimizing warehouse and MFCs fulfillment, and continuously improving on-time delivery performance. Your strategic approach will balance lead time and cost, ensuring budget adherence while delivering exceptional service to both internal and external stakeholders.
